Transcribed Image Text:**Fourier Series and MATLAB Visualization**
**Objective**: Find the Fourier representation of the function \( f(x) \) and use MATLAB to plot the graph of \( f(x) \) along with the partial sums of the Fourier series of order 2nd (\( S_2 \)) and 20th (\( S_{20} \)).
**Function Definition**:
The piecewise function \( f(x) \) is defined as follows:
\[
f(x) =
\begin{cases}
\frac{\pi}{2}, & -\pi \leq x \leq 0 \\
x + \frac{\pi}{2}, & 0 < x \leq \frac{\pi}{2} \\
\frac{3\pi}{2} - x, & \frac{\pi}{2} < x \leq \pi
\end{cases}
\]
**Instructions**:
1. **Fourier Representation**:
- Derive the Fourier coefficients for the given function \( f(x) \).
- Construct the Fourier series using these coefficients.
2. **MATLAB Visualization**:
- Implement the function and its Fourier series in MATLAB.
- Plot the original function \( f(x) \).
- Additionally, plot the partial Fourier sums of order 2 (\( S_2 \)) and order 20 (\( S_{20} \)).
These steps will allow for a visual comparison of the original function with its approximations via the Fourier series.
